原文:网络流—最大流(Edmond-Karp算法)

网络流看了两天,终于有了一点眉目,也拿模版A了道题目,通过对于模版代码的调试也真正了解了ek算法的用途了。 想好好写下总结都不让人顺心,写到一半网站死了,又得重新写。。 不说废话了,直接正题 首先要先清楚最大流的含义,就是说从源点到经过的所有路径的最终到达汇点的所有流量和 EK算法的核心 反复寻找源点s到汇点t之间的增广路径,若有,找出增广路径上每一段 容量 流量 的最小值delta,若无,则结束 ...

2013-01-27 15:35 4 25531 推荐指数:

查看详情

网络最大流-Dinic算法

 摘自https://www.cnblogs.com/SYCstudio/p/7260613.html 网络定义    在图论中,网络(Network flow)是指在一个每条边都有容量(Capacity)的有向图分配,使一条边的流量不会超过它的容量。通常在运筹学中,有向图称为网络 ...

Wed May 08 23:22:00 CST 2019 0 1450
网络(二)最大流的增广路算法

传送门: 网络(一)基础知识篇 网络(二)最大流的增广路算法 网络(三)最大流最小割定理 网络(四)dinic算法 网络(五)有上下限的最大流 网络(六)最小费用最大流问题 转载:https://www.cnblogs.com ...

Mon Apr 16 20:50:00 CST 2018 0 4211
网络--最大流

开始总以为网络是多么高深的东西,一直不敢去接受,然而学完以后发现好像也不是太难哦,只是好多基础东西的一些整合。 文章中可能会有多出纰漏,敬请读者不吝赐教。 我们以一个经典的问题引入算法。 你所在的村庄新开通了地下流水管道,自来水厂源源不断的提供水,村民们用水直接或间接用水,而村庄 ...

Tue Aug 28 17:18:00 CST 2018 6 17809
网络最大流算法

网络最大流是指在一个网络图中可以从源点流到汇点的最大的流量。求解网络最大流的常用算法可以分为增广路径算法和预推进算法。其中,预推进算法的理论复杂度优于增广路径算法,但是编码复杂度过高,且效率优势在很多时候并不是很明显,因此,经常使用的算法为增广路径算法。 增广路径算法主要有 ...

Fri Oct 16 09:21:00 CST 2015 1 6413
三种网络最大流)的实现算法讲解与代码

[洛谷P3376题解]网络最大流)的实现算法讲解与代码 更坏的阅读体验 定义 对于给定的一个网络,有向图中每个的边权表示可以通过的最大流量。假设出发点S水流无限大,求水流到终点T后的最大流量。 起点我们一般称为源点,终点一般称为汇点 内容前置 1.增广路 ​ 在一个网络从源点S ...

Wed Aug 11 00:06:00 CST 2021 0 160
网络最大流的增广路径算法

扩展:多路增广 一般的,在执行增广路算法时,都是先用BFS或DFS从源到汇找到一条增广路,记录下应修改的流量,然后再顺着路倒回去增广.反复这个过程直到增广路找不到了为止. 显然的,我们做了很多无用功,假设有两条很长的增广路,前面大部分都是重叠的,只是在最后关头分了个岔 ...

Tue Nov 04 04:30:00 CST 2014 0 2244
网络(五)有上下限的最大流

传送门: 网络(一)基础知识篇 网络(二)最大流的增广路算法 网络(三)最大流最小割定理 网络(四)dinic算法 网络(五)有上下限的最大流 网络(六)最小费用最大流问题 转自:https://blog.csdn.net/water_glass/article ...

Tue Apr 17 06:34:00 CST 2018 0 1177
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M